Abstract

The investment on the multi-purpose microwave furnace system is the core to deliver this project on Bay Campus and will be also made available to all other department members and the School of Engineering and Applied Sciences it belongs to. The Department of Chemical Engineering has strong research expertise in the fields of Resources, Processes, and Materials, and plays a crucial role in supporting local Welsh-based industry. It is within the Resources and Materials themes that we develop innovative solutions to tackle global challenges related to energy, water, and decarbonisation. The development of materials and technologies for energy storage and conversion, membranes for water treatment, decarbonisation and sensors technologies are critically dependent on the availability of working, robust and reliable experimental equipment.
